About a year and a half ago, I received a gift certificate for Tucano's restuarant in Winchester. What a great gift that turned out to be. My wife and I were so pleased with the menu variety and quality of the food (including its preparation and presentation) that we think it is the best food in the area (and there are a lot of excellent eating places around here). In fact, we've both agreed that it's probably the best food we've ever tasted anywhere.
We've taken our family there and they love it. Recommend it highly!
Recommended dishes: Don't hold me to the names of the dishes we've tried, but all have been delicious. We frequently order two pasta based items that are among our favorites... one is a pasta base with chicken, and a sauce that has onion, olives, tomatoes and other ingredients that make the most delicate and tasty sauce you could ever hope to come across... this is not a typical Italian type dish... it is very special. The other pasta dish is one I really like... the main ingredient is hearts of palm, along with onion, tomato (sun dried and fresh) and a white cream sauce that's out of this world. We've also had a shrimp presentation that is worth going back for, and our grandson loved their steak offerings. The soups are extra special, (oh my! that potato soup is the best), and although we've not yet tried a main salad, the small salad provided with the lunch menu is so good, that the other listed salads have just got to be wonderful-good... and their garlic bread is a great addition to any meal you might order. This is not a Brazilian restaurant... It used to be, but apparently TGI Friday's has recently taken over. Is Jack Daniel's steak a popular menu item in Manaus?
The menu has changed dramatically since it opened in 1995, and not for the better. It is now about 15 percent Brazilian, 75 percent random suburban trendy menu items. [06 May 2004 16:06:35]
